African Neckwear Art Activity

Encourage children to explore African tribal art and patterns with this interesting travel art activity that will allow them to create fun, decorative necklaces using just black pens and paper plates!

Art ActivityThis travel art can be done in:

  • Cars
  • Planes
  • Trains
  • Hotel rooms

 

What you will need:

  • Paper plates
  • Black felt tip pens
  • Safety scissors

 

Directions:

  1. Cut the paper plates into a ‘C’ shape so they will sit around the neck.
  2. Put all drawing materials in a plastic lidded box ready for transporting. Give your children a tray to work on.
  3. Invite your child to design his or her own African-inspired neckwear by experimenting with geometric patterns. It’s really effective to work exclusively in black and white. (You can find some inspiration here.)
  4. Wear it like a necklace!
